    On Saturday I smoked 12 lbs of almonds of four different ways.

    I followed recipes all from this forum.

    First left to right is
    just salted almonds
    then
    honey, brown sugar and salt





    then left to right is
    butter, worcestershire sauce, Tabasco sauce, dry mustard, granulated garlic, wasabi, sea salt
    then on the right
    egg whites, whole blanched almonds, brown sugar, ground cinnamon, chili powder, cumin, salt, cayenne

          Now that they have cooled and set over night they are all great!!

          the favorite is the

          egg whites, brown sugar, ground cinnamon, chili powder, cumin, salt, cayenne coated ones.

          2nd would go to the just plain salt cause all the flavoring comes from the smoke.
